Obituary Biography Bradley Lawrence, 65, of Beaufort, beloved and devoted husband, father, and grandfather, departed from his temporary earthly home on Friday, August 22, 2014. He was called by his Lord and Savior, Jesus Christ, to his eternal home in Gloryland. There, he will be welcomed by his loved ones, who are waiting for him with open arms. He will be there to someday welcome with open arms his wife, soul mate, and best friend, Terri. He also leaves behind his sons, Kevin Lawrence and his wife, Lee, of Cedar Island, Barry Day and his wife, Mandy, of Atlantic Beach; his daughter, Alicia Lawrence of Otway; and two granddaughters, April Lawrence and Allison Warren, both of Otway. He is also survived by his father-in-law, Darwood (Dee) Lewis of Morehead City, as well as two brothers and two sisters and their families, which includes Gregory and Nancy Lawrence of Otway. He was preceded in death by his mother, Agnes Marie Gillikin Lawrence and his father, Wilbert Lawrence. Bradley was a hard working, loving, devoted, and loyal family man who always put the needs of his family above his own. He will be dearly missed and never forgotten by his family and his many friends. He made an impression on everyone he ever met. He completed his earthly duties for the Lord and his family here on earth and met his ultimate goal to go forth to meet Jesus and to have everlasting life. His Going Home service will be Thursday, August 28, 2014, at 2:00 p.m., at Ocean View Cemetery, 1200 Ann Street, Beaufort, NC, with Pastor Richard Patterson, officiating. In lieu of flowers, donations may be made to St. Judes Childrens Research Hospital, P. O. Box 50, Memphis, TN 38101.
